Love Locking - Taken September 2010
Pont des Arts bridge, Paris



Now in Paris; the global city of love... well known for its romantic cafes, restaurants, monuments and cobbled streets, the lover's growing trend of sticking 'Cadenas d'amour' (Love Padlocks) on the Pont Des Arts bridge over the Seine has vastly increased its popularity (Being the ultimate love trend).
                                               
Having travelled to Paris on several occasions, and visited the Pont des Arts bridge (no, not because I have many loves to lockup unfortunately, but there’s also a lot of fascinating things to see at this location) the increase in love locking is astonishing, maybe even more when you see it with your own eyes!
